4 Affiliate Promo Sequence Mistakes Speakers Make

Don't Do ThisDo This Instead
Relying solely on verbal mentions from stage without a clear call to action or follow-up mechanism.
Integrate a clear call to action with a trackable link (e.g., a QR code on a slide, a dedicated landing page) into your presentation slides or follow-up materials.
Promoting too many products at once, which dilutes your message and confuses your audience.
Focus on a select few, high-value products that genuinely align with your niche, audience needs, and the core message of your speaking engagements.
Not having a dedicated system or tool to track affiliate sales, commissions, and the performance of your promotions.
Utilize a CRM, email marketing tool, or specialized affiliate marketing software like [PRODUCT NAME] to monitor performance, automate follow-ups, and improve your promotions.
Sounding overly salesy or inauthentic when promoting products, which can damage your credibility as a speaker.
Frame recommendations as genuine solutions to your audience's problems, sharing personal experiences and demonstrating your belief in the product's value and results.

Customize Affiliate Promo Sequence for Your Speaker Specialty

Adapt these templates for your specific industry.

Keynote Speakers

  • Integrate a relevant affiliate product into your keynote narrative as a real-world solution to a common challenge, weaving it into your story naturally.
  • Include a QR code on a 'resources' slide that links directly to your affiliate offer page for immediate post-keynote engagement from interested attendees.
  • Follow up with a dedicated email to attendees (if permitted), referencing the tool you mentioned and providing your affiliate link with a clear benefit statement.

Workshop Speakers

  • Incorporate the affiliate product as a practical tool within your workshop exercises, demonstrating its value live as participants learn and apply concepts.
  • Offer a 'toolkit' or 'resource guide' to participants that includes your recommended affiliate products, with explanations of how they enhance the workshop's learning outcomes.
  • Run a brief Q&A session specifically about tools and resources, allowing you to naturally introduce and explain the benefits of your affiliate recommendations.

Corporate Speakers

  • Position affiliate products as 'enterprise solutions' or 'team productivity tools' that directly address common corporate pain points or goals discussed in your presentations.
  • Create a concise 'recommended resources' document for corporate clients, detailing how specific affiliate products can support their organizational objectives and improve results.
  • Suggest a pilot program for a recommended tool within the organization, guiding them through the setup process and providing your affiliate link for their team's adoption.

Motivational Speakers

  • Align affiliate products with personal growth, productivity, or mindset-shifting goals that resonate deeply with your motivational message and audience aspirations.
  • Share personal testimonials about how you use the product to maintain your own motivation, achieve personal breakthroughs, or simplify your daily habits.
  • Integrate the affiliate product into a 'challenge' or 'accountability program' that your audience can join, positioning the product as a core component for achieving transformational results.
